I persnoaly dump a quart of ATF in every tank started in gillette at the mines. Helps with gelling and adds a but of lube back to the mix also helps clean it up.

This is what I do. The place I usually fill up at has no-name atf for two bucks a quart. Since I've started doing this, I've noticed a little bit better mileage, a little more power, slightly quieter running and my metering valve not sticking.
